In general, after changing the provider from Rnet to Beeline, the first problem first appeared - there was no Internet on the PC and also on the phone via wifi, but at the same time the TV set was working, which was connected to the set-top box, which was connected to the router via a wire.

The firmware of the router helped, I can easily surf the Internet (watch videos on YouTube, VK and much more) from a PC and also from a phone, but I cannot play some online games (CS: GO, PlanetSide 2, Heroes & General , War Thunder ...), there are also other games (PUBG, Escape from tarkov) that work fine. I tried to upgrade to other firmware, tried to open ports, turned on NAT-DMZ, turned off the firewall on the router, nothing helps.

If you plug the wire directly into the PC, then everything is buzzing and there are no problems. I've been sitting for a week now and I don't know what to do, please help.

Why don't the online games listed by you work through a router? No connection to the server, or is there another problem? There are no other computers / laptops connected to this router? It would be possible to check if these games work on another computer. This would eliminate the problem on the PC (Windows) / game side. Which router?

As a rule, these games automatically work through any router, and you do not need to configure anything and open ports. Everything is configurable and works thanks to the UPnP function.

For some reason it seems to me that your router is incorrectly configured. As far as I know, Beeline uses L2TP or PPTP connection type. Have you selected the type of connection in the router settings, specified the login / password and server name (check this information with the provider)? You don't need to start a high-speed connection on your computer.

Perhaps these online games are not working due to incorrect router settings. Others still work because of the peculiarities in the connection. I would reset the router settings, set up the correct Internet connection (ISP) and already look further. Since there all these port forwarding and other settings that you already did, can only get in the way.
